Despite the attempts... Aoun: A return to the civil war is not on the cards
Fady Mahouly
The President of the Republic, General Joseph Aoun, thanked the “American Action Group for Lebanon” for its constant support for Lebanon and its people, and for its efforts to strengthen Lebanon’s sovereignty and independence, calling for support for the “framework formula” that was reached with Israel under American auspices.
During a video call with the group, Aoun stressed that the Lebanese army and security forces constitute the cornerstone of stability and security in the south, ensuring the return of the people to their areas and homes.
He stressed that "there is no place for civil war in Lebanon, and that its return to the scene is not on the table, despite all attempts aimed at awakening strife."
He also stressed the importance of the deployment of the Lebanese army along the border, calling for putting pressure on Israel to withdraw from the lands it occupies in Lebanon, considering that "the continued occupation undermines the legitimacy of the state, prevents the deployment of the army, and obstructs the foundations for achieving just and lasting peace."
He pointed out that if Israel continues to occupy Lebanese lands, this will not serve the goals set by the United States and Lebanon to restore the state’s sovereignty and independence and enhance the strength of its institutions.
